Etymology edit

sub- +‎ theory

Noun edit

subtheory (plural subtheories)

  1. A theory forming part of a larger theory.
    • 2016, Ross Duncan, Kevin Dunne, “Interacting Frobenius Algebras are Hopf”, in arXiv[1]:
      We recover the system of Bonchi et al as a subtheory in the prime power dimensional case, but the more general theory does not arise from a distributive law.
